Is there ever pickup soccer here regularly?
Address: 320 N McDowell Blvd, Petaluma, CA 94954, USA
galen humes | Aug 20, 2021
Yes I think so
Eliza Kasinger | Aug 20, 2021
Not sure, Not from the area just visiting, love it though 😉
Bobbi O'Sullivan | Aug 20, 2021
Yes from time to time.
Twone B | Aug 20, 2021
Sometimes.
Thanks! Your answer is awaiting moderation.